USB, DVI, HDMI Connectors

1. Overview

Connectors and interconnects are critical components enabling data transmission and power delivery between electronic devices. USB (Universal Serial Bus), DVI (Digital Visual Interface), and HDMI (High-Definition Multimedia Interface) represent standardized interface technologies that have revolutionized digital connectivity. These interfaces facilitate seamless integration of peripherals, displays, and multimedia equipment in modern computing, entertainment, and industrial systems.

3. Structural Composition

USB Connectors: Consist of plastic housing, metal contacts (typically phosphor bronze with gold plating), and overmolding strain relief. Type-C variants feature 24 contacts arranged in dual rows.

DVI Connectors: Incorporate a 24+1/24+5 pin arrangement (digital/analog hybrid), with screw locking mechanisms in some variants. Use differential signaling pairs for high-speed data transfer.

HDMI Connectors: Contain 19 pins in Type A configuration, with dedicated channels for TMDS (Transition Minimized Differential Signaling), CEC (Consumer Electronics Control), and Hot Plug Detect.

7. Selection Recommendations

Consider these factors when choosing connectors:

  • Bandwidth Requirements: Match interface speed to application needs (e.g., HDMI 2.1 for 8K video)
  • Physical Constraints: Space limitations favor miniaturized variants (HDMI Type D, USB Type-C)
  • Power Delivery: USB PD 3.0 supports up to 240W for charging applications
  • Environmental Conditions: Industrial environments require connectors with IP67 ratings
  • Future-Proofing: Select latest generation interfaces (USB4, HDMI 2.1) for long-term compatibility
